Munaf Manji and Mackenzie Rivers talk NBA offseason moves and much more. The NBA offseason has been anything but quiet, with retirements, betting controversies, and opening night matchups fueling headlines. John Wall officially retired after an injury-filled career that began with promise in Washington, while Derrick Rose will have his No. 1 jersey retired by the Chicago Bulls, honoring his MVP peak before injuries changed his trajectory. Off-court drama also made waves as Malik Beasley was cleared in a federal gambling investigation, reopening his free agency with interest from the Detroit Pistons and New York Knicks. The case highlighted growing concerns over NBA betting integrity, with discussions about limiting unders on fringe players after scandals involving Jonte Porter. Opening night brings high drama. The Oklahoma City Thunder, fresh off their championship, host the Houston Rockets, who now feature Kevin Durant in a stunning return to OKC. Oddsmakers list the Thunder as 6.5-point favorites, backed by continuity, elite net rating, and Shai Gilgeous-Alexander's MVP form. Analysts expect Durant and Jalen Green to thrive in Houston but caution that defensive chemistry will take time after trading away Dillon Brooks. The second marquee game pits the Golden State Warriors against the Los Angeles Lakers. Steph Curry, Draymond Green, and Jimmy Butler headline a Warriors roster built on stability, while the Lakers counter with Luka Doncic alongside LeBron James at age 41. Experts argue Golden State is undervalued, pointing to their cohesion and defensive strength compared to the Lakers' questionable fit and reliance on Luka's offense. Debate then shifted to overrated and underrated stars entering the 2025–26 season. Anthony Edwards, despite highlight dunks and hype, was criticized for inconsistency, limited playmaking, and average defense in key playoff series. Trae Young's efficiency, turnovers, and defensive liability made him another overrated pick, while LeBron James was called statistically brilliant yet less impactful on winning at this stage of his career. Ja Morant's injuries and lack of reliable shooting lowered his stock, and even fan-favorite Alex Caruso was labeled overrated due to inflated advanced metrics. On the underrated side, Joel Embiid was deemed far too low on rankings despite injury concerns, still a dominant force when healthy. Orlando's Franz Wagner was praised for versatility, scoring, and leadership alongside Paolo Banchero, positioning him as a rising top-15 talent. Jalen Williams of the Thunder was highlighted as a two-way star capable of being more than a Robin, while Bam Adebayo's defense and potential offensive leap could transform Miami. Even Steph Curry, though widely respected, was argued to remain underrated for the way he elevates teammates. The podcast closed with betting insights. The Los Angeles Clippers were recommended at -8 over the rebuilding Utah Jazz, given depth, continuity, and elite defense led by Kawhi Leonard and James Harden. Another best bet circled the Toronto Raptors +6 against the Atlanta Hawks, citing Brandon Ingram's addition, improved depth, and Atlanta's poor record as home favorites. As the 2025–26 season approaches, the NBA's mix of star power, betting intrigue, and opening-night storylines ensures drama on and off the court. From Durant's OKC return to debates over Edwards, Young, and Embiid, fans and bettors alike have plenty to watch. The association never sleeps, and this season promises to be another defining chapter. Learn more about your ad choices. Visit megaphone.fm/adchoices
